Introduction

The luxury Bush Camp is situated in a wilderness area, 3km from the main camp at Okonjima, a private reserve for the conservation of big cats, in particular cheetah and lion.

Okonjima Bush Camp consists of 8 thatched African-style chalets and a main lapa-style complex housing reception, lounge with fire place, kitchen, dining area and curio shop. The building is shaped rather like a camel-thorn pod, with a campfire area in its curve that overlooks a waterhole, and a swimming pool to one side.

Each unique African-style chalet is completely secluded and private. The chalets are a combination of earthy orange clay walls, khaki-green canvas and thatched roofs. The front 180 degrees is comprised of canvas panels which may be rolled up inviting you to enjoy your private bushveld vista.
